Residents are invited to help protect local waterways during the 2026 Broward Waterway Cleanup, set for Saturday, March 7, at Riverside Park in Coral Springs.
The annual cleanup, held on the first Saturday in March, encourages community members to remove litter and debris from waterways throughout Broward County. In Coral Springs, volunteers will gather at Riverside Park, 205 Coral Ridge Drive, along the C-14 Canal.
Students participating in the event can receive community service hours for their volunteer work.
Organizers will provide event T-shirts, plastic bags, litter grabbers, water, and directions to cleanup locations while supplies last. Participants are encouraged to bring comfortable clothing and be prepared for outdoor conditions.
